Komma igång med CPLD/FPGA

Elektronikrelaterade (på komponentnivå) frågor och funderingar.
frejo
Inlägg: 496
Blev medlem: 21 april 2004, 21:43:01
Ort: Linköping

Komma igång med CPLD/FPGA

Inlägg av frejo »

Hej
Jag har ett gäng mach210 kretsar liggandes hemma och skulle vilja ha lite hjälp att komma igång och använda dom.

Vad krävs för att koppla upp den? kristall etc...
Har nån ett kopplingsschema för uppkoppling av denna eller liknande kretsar?
Vad programmerar jag med? jtag?
Vilken programvara krävs? finns det freeware?

Har använt en mindre CPLD på ett utvecklingskit i skolan för några år sen så lite VHDL kunskap har jag...

Tacksam för all hjälp.

Datablad:
http://hep.physics.lsa.umich.edu/alpha/ ... e%3Apdf%22
Senast redigerad av frejo 29 augusti 2006, 22:03:43, redigerad totalt 2 gånger.
Användarvisningsbild
exile
EF Sponsor
Inlägg: 496
Blev medlem: 21 oktober 2005, 23:32:07

Inlägg av exile »

Tyvär finns det nog ingen freeware till dem, och få tag på den mjukvara som behövs är nog oxå väldigt svårt...

Så det är nog enklare att välja en tillverkare som tillhanda håller mjukvara som xilinx och altera...
d99dan
Inlägg: 23
Blev medlem: 27 januari 2006, 12:08:25

Inlägg av d99dan »

Varför skulle det vara svårt att få tag på mjukvara? Freeware däremot blir nog svårt. Jag har inte använt det själv något men tror att de använder en egen kabel.

EDIT Jag sökte på google första sidan fick upp två länkar till programmerare en från ICE och en från HILO. Dessutom så visade det sig att det finns även freeware, den första software development system i listan i databladet som du länkade till men inte verkar ha läst är MACHXL från AMD och den finns numera som freeware på http://noel.feld.cvut.cz/hw/amd/mxl21sw_.html en konstig adress men det var den första träffen på google
frejo
Inlägg: 496
Blev medlem: 21 april 2004, 21:43:01
Ort: Linköping

Inlägg av frejo »

Tack för svaren.
Har dock bestämt mig för att köpa ett färdigt kit nu, tar för mycket tid att bygga ett. Känns bättre att få lägga lite mer tid på kodning.

Har hittat några intressanta kit och undrar om nån har erfarenhet av dom:

UP2 från Altera är ett kit som även stöds i litteraturen till en kurs jag läser just nu.
http://www.buyaltera.com/scripts/partse ... 44-1293-ND

Sen hittade jag ett Spartan-3 kort från digilent som verkar vara lite mer att åka med prestandamässigt, eller är jag helt fel här?
http://www.digilentinc.com/Products/Det ... ogrammable

Det häftigaste kortet verkar vara detta:
http://www.digilentinc.com/Products/Det ... ogrammable
Ett Spartan-3E kort med mycket ram, ethernet, usb, dac, adc osv
Frågan är om det är rätt att börja med, kanske lite overkill.


Så frågan är om jag ska använda Alterakortet som har både FPGA och CPLD och som jag har kodexempel till eller om jag ska satsa på ett Spartan-3 kort, som verkar ha lite mer prestanda, inte säker på det då detta är nytt för mig.

Synpunkter?
cyr
Inlägg: 2712
Blev medlem: 27 maj 2003, 16:02:39
Ort: linköping
Kontakt:

Inlägg av cyr »

UP2-kitet är bra om man vill lära sig lite enklare saker från grunden, men det är nog inte värt de pengarna. Jag har ett sånt här, men det är endast därför att jag lånade det på obestämd tid en gång för länge sen... :oops:

Jag skulle nog ha satsat på Spartan3-kortet om jag var i din situation, om du inte har några speciella stora planer redan nu. Man får väldigt mycket grejer för priset på kortet för $150, men som nybörjare har man kanske mer nytta av knappar och LED-displayer än DDR-minne och ethernet.
frejo
Inlägg: 496
Blev medlem: 21 april 2004, 21:43:01
Ort: Linköping

Inlägg av frejo »

Det blev ett Spartan-3E kort tillslut. Tack för hjälpen!
Bild
Skriv svar